Free Christmas parking will be offered on certain days in most town centre council run car parks in the run-up to Christmas to help support local businesses and rejuvenate the high street.
 
Free parking will be offered on Sundays in Windsor (Maidenhead is already free) and on Wednesdays after 3pm in both Maidenhead and Windsor in most council run town centre car parks.
 
Councillor David Cannon, lead member for public protection and parking, says: “I am delighted that we have been able to bring a small amount of Christmas cheer to our residents and I hope that this supports our local independent businesses who have had a difficult year.
 
“The offer is available to residents and visitors and we would encourage people to take advantage of this in the run-up to Christmas to support our local high streets.
 
“We are committed to supporting our local businesses and boosting our local economy.”
 
The free parking will be on Wednesdays from 3pm in both Windsor and Maidenhead Royal Borough town centre car parks on 9, 16 and 23 December. It will also be free on Sundays in Windsor on 6, 13 and 20 December. Maidenhead is already free on Sundays. River Street in Windsor is excluded from this offer.
